Output 105f10c3dd8e43449236befbaa87a129601cd4d214bd4568922bb31f665f874c:1

value
68978246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f54dad0c0a3bac51eee69ea4ba0a536e48c14a4 OP_EQUALVERIFY OP_CHECKSIG
address
1JSfiT9exYwJ4CAtAvBwk3d4UpHvpWaffx
transaction
105f10c3dd8e43449236befbaa87a129601cd4d214bd4568922bb31f665f874c
spent
true